Skip to content

dekanat/aparat

 
 

Repository files navigation

Ներկայացումներ հավանական երևույթների շուրջ, կիրառական ապարատների մասնակցությամբ։

Local Development

Setup

npx elm-tooling install

Testing

Փորձերի ու չափումների համար աշխատացրեք տեստերը

npx elm-test

Ընթացքում տեստերի արդյունքները շարունակաբար տեսնելու համար սեղմեք

npx elm-test --watch

Running in browser

Ընթացքում ծրագրի աշխատանքին հետևելու համար սեղմեք

npx elm-watch@beta hot

ապա բացեք տրամադրված լինկը բրաուզերով

Contributing

Introducing changes

Կոդը կարելի ա փոխել միանգամից հիմնական բռենչի վրա, բայց ընկերներով աշխատելու դեպքում կարա ցանկալի լինի Pull Request-ներով, որպես նայել քննարկելու հարմար1 վարիանտ։

Ամեն դեպքում փոփոխությունները պետք ա լինեն կոնկրետ, ու հնարավորինս փոքր։ Ավելի մանրամասն commit-ների մասին՝ տես հավելվածը։

Publishing online

Պուբլիկացիայի ավտոմատիկան թարմացնում ա սայտը հիմնական main բռենչի վրա փոփոխությունների ժամանակ։

Եթե այլ բռենչերից ա պետք, էլի հնարավոր ա գնալ ձեռով գործարկել
  1. Navigate to the Publishing action tab in GitHub Actions
  2. Select the appropriate workflow and branch
  3. Click the "Run workflow" button (կոճակը)

image

Footnotes

  1. Որպես հարմարություն, Pull Request-ների վրա միացրած ա որակավորման ավտոմատիկա՝ տեստերը, կոդի ձևաչափը, և նման բաներ ստուգելու համար։

Languages

  • Elm 92.1%
  • Elixir 5.5%
  • HTML 2.4%